Rent The Most Effective Freelance Java Developers

We wanted some short-term work in Scala, and Toptal discovered us a fantastic developer within 24 hours. Despite accelerating demand for coders, Toptal prides itself on nearly Ivy League-level vetting.

Entry-level Java engineers start at $99,577 annually within the United States, while Java specialists can command a salary of $147,891 yearly. Below, we’ll listing the hard and gentle skills you’ll want to look for in a Java developer for rent, beginning with an evaluation of hard expertise. The listing of abilities can be elevated depending on the particular necessities of your project.

Strong type-checking and efficient memory administration enhances robustness and reliability. In addition to all the above, it’s worth saying that Java programming language grants its pundits many extra bonuses. Having 9 years in software growth and powerful backgrong in Java and microservices, Erion has additionally dived into Blockchain world just lately, mastering Solidity.

The Worth Of Rent Dedicated Java Developer

Have an urgent project that requires complicated database dealing with and needs to be launched quicker to market? Hire OpenXava developer and increase them in your app Development Team to speed up your Java project completion. Hire Blade Developer from Aglowid to leverage the light-weight open-source template engine for creating advanced enterprise-grade net apps on Java.

For example, I am at present designing and building a DevSecOps system for a Silicon Valley AI firm, and I’m also in management of utility security critiques. We don’t cost something when you publish a freelance hiring request for Java developers! You’ll have the chance to determine what the price range in your project is whenever you submit the request. You’ll only need to pay the developer if you’re 100% satisfied with their work.

  • I do not have to worry about discovering new clients and the businesses I’m related to are always a joy to work with.
  • Both are useful in path of establishing a proper memory administration system in place and avoiding reminiscence leaks or inefficient useful resource utilization.
  • Inside the ‘Birds’ constructor, the ‘super(name)’ assertion is used for calling the constructor in the ‘Birds’ class.
  • The best place to engage devoted software program improvement teams is an company specializing in software program growth.
  • Therefore, the Integer object returned by one call to Integer.valueOf(127) will match the Integer object returned by one other call to Integer.valueOf(127), since it is cached.

Since each new Integer(5) creates a brand new object, one new Integer(5) will not equal another new Integer(5). One of the commonest and efficient methods for avoiding these points is to make use of meaningful, non-null defaults. In different words, simply avoid utilizing null to the extent you could.

We have been matched with an distinctive freelancer from Argentina who, from Day 1, immersed himself in our trade, blended seamlessly with our group, understood our imaginative and prescient, and produced top-notch results. Toptal makes connecting with superior builders and programmers very easy. The concept of overriding in Java applies to instance strategies and never hire java developer static strategies. It is used for conditions where a subclass wants to supply a special implementation for a method then the one already supplied by its superclass. A static variable shall be a class-level variable that has solely a single copy and gets shared by all class cases.

Rent Us

Manual has created multi-tenant sites for trend retailers in France, Belgium, and the USA. He has introduced on the SAP TechEds in Las Vegas and Amsterdam and has contributed to the coaching of employees at previous roles. Very professional, accurate and environment friendly team regardless of all of the adjustments I had them do.

All concrete subclasses are therefore assured to honor the API specified by the summary methods in the summary class they inherit from. This is somewhat much like the way during which a Java interface specifies an API for all courses that implement it. Allows companies to shortly assemble groups that have the proper expertise for particular projects. Its intensive class libraries comprise a huge selection of capabilities and nuances, a lot of which are misplaced on the average developer.

What Java Growth Course Of Do You Follow?

Julie has over 20 years of experience constructing software program functions and main engineering groups for companies of all sizes. She has experience in Java, JavaScript, C, C++, and Perl, and is familiar with many well-liked frameworks. Recently, Julie designed and implemented a large-scale Oracle database sharding resolution for Walmart.com. Having chosen the best candidates, you should begin with gentle expertise interviews. They assist you to perceive if the candidates’ soft abilities (time administration, empathy, remote/onsite work expertise, teamwork experience) comply with the job you offer. Building knowledge analysis instruments, creating software program platforms, or maintaining cell apps — Java developers can deal with it with no sweat.

freelance dedicated java developers

Libraries are a set of ready features, objects, fashions, lessons, etc., used to address project duties. Build automation instruments enable the automation of duties when creating, executing and testing applications. To save time and resources in Java-based programming, builders ought to have a deal with on generally used build tools similar to Maven or Gradle. The importance of onerous skills for a software program engineer is self-explanatory, however soft abilities are also vital for a team member to work with different people successfully. If you hire Java builders with Lemon.io, we are going to prevent the effort of hiring. Our standard screening and onboarding mechanism allows you to save loads of time (and spend it on development as an alternative of burdensome HR activities).

The Means To Rent The Best Java Developers?

Our top handpicked builders, engineers, architects and designers. When you contact JayDevs via Contact US or the ‘Hire Developers’ button on our web site, we are going to get back to you within 24 hours. When you rent Java developers by way of JayDevs, they can start work within seven days. When creating Java purposes, it’s subsequently advisable to have staff sign a non-disclosure agreement to guard critical information. It’s prudent to set out extra costs in an agreement earlier than a project is started. This permits for unforeseen points, similar to issues that require the extension of a deadline, bringing additional resources to the table, or extending the contract.

Those who’ve mastered the language can have a big constructive impact in your team’s productivity and on your system’s efficiency. Here are some focused questions to help determine true masters of the language. Toptal’s screening and matching course of ensures exceptional expertise are matched to your exact wants. Manuel is a licensed Demandware developer and IT systems Engineer. His experience lies in ERP and eCommerce systems, including store design, advertising, analytics, material administration, and manufacturing planning.

He is passionate about technology and value-driven projects, and he is extremely adaptable. Luigi has been part of significant industry transformation waves directly from some of the leaders driving the digital period. This is a kind of inheritance the place a class is in a position to inherit properties and habits from more than a single mother or father. The ‘Birds’ class overrid the ‘makeSound()’ method from the ‘Birds’ class. Inside the overridden ‘makeSound()’ methodology in the ‘Birds’ class, the ‘super.makeSound()’ statement calls the ‘makeSound()’ methodology. This first executes the ‘makeSound() method in ‘Birds’ class and later executes the relaxation of the code in the ‘Kingfisher’ class.

freelance dedicated java developers

Now, the chosen last candidate will onboard your team inside 24–48 hours after last affirmation. Interview the chosen candidate the place you can assess their abilities via theoretical & practical questions. Pick one of the best candidates from our prime Java Developers’ Profiles to continue. From Java packages to whole https://www.globalcloudteam.com/ manufacturing, our skilled Java Engineers possess strong publicity in each phase of Project growth & support. Flexiple helps corporations build the very best group by scouting and figuring out the best fit.

Once you’ve gone via our screening course of, you’ll become the latest member of the Toptal Network, and our staff will begin connecting you to thrilling tasks with global purchasers. Every client in our community understands our screening course of, so when you’re picking up new work, you won’t must do any traditional interviewing. Christina is a senior QA engineer with expertise in check automation, check management, and manual testing for internet and cell applications.

If you rent Java programmers on-line who work outdoors the USA or Western Europe, you can make important savings. For instance, Lithuanian software program growth company JayDevs has senior Java builders and above who work for an hourly fee which ranges from $32 to $62. In some instances, startup homeowners choose performing code critiques on the job interview to see if the programmer can analyze their code and ponder in regards to the best/worst/quickest options.

They are mainly used for controlling the extent of encapsulation and limiting entry to sure parts of a class. JavaBeans is a design pattern that comes with a set of conventions for constructing reusable and modular elements. They represent information in object-oriented manner and are generally utilized in GUI growth. Hence, if a subclass defines a method with the same signature because the static technique in its superclass, it is not thought of an override. And a Static Class is a category in Java that cannot be instantiated and all its members are static.

Leave a Reply

Your email address will not be published. Required fields are marked *